Perched on the shores of Lake Superior, Duluth is a beautiful port city in Minnesota that boasts endless options. It is popularly known as the home of the unique Aerial Lift Bridge that stretches across the Duluth Ship Canal. Spirit Mountain Recreation Area is a hot spot for adrenaline junkies and thrill-seekers coming to ski and to indulge in other exhilarating activities, such as mountain climbing and hiking. Surprise your kids with a tour of Great Lakes Aquarium or a visit to Lake Superior Zoo. Other places you may want to visit include Glensheen Mansion and Jay Cooke State Park. In addition, your adventures won’t be complete without a taste of Duluth’s famous bubble teas. Read on to learn more about the top bubble tea in Duluth, Minnesota.

1. T-Icy Roll Ice Cream

Posted by T-Icy Roll Ice Cream Grand Ave on Friday, December 4, 2020

Located along Grand Avenue in the heart of Duluth, T-Icy Roll Ice Cream is popular for its mouth-watering ice creams and refreshing bubble teas. While exploring the vibrant streets of Duluth, you can hop by and satisfy your cravings with some delicious treats. You can also order takeaway for later.

Their colorful menu comprises different varieties of sushi, ice cream flavors, and beverages like bubble tea, fruit tea, smoothies, slushes, and various flavors of hot chocolate. This shop is a great place to bring your significant other for a treat.

T-Icy Roll Ice Cream

Address: 4602 Grand Ave, Duluth, MN 55807, United States

Website: T-Icy Roll Ice Cream

Opening hours: Sun - Thu: 12pm - 9pm; Fri - Sat: 12pm - 10pm

2. Cloud 9

For a memorable gastronomical experience, head to Cloud 9. This Asian restaurant along Lake Avenue will make you salivate with its expansive menu. Whether it’s sushi, hibachi-grilled seafood, or Chinese and Thai specialties, Cloud 9 has it all. The restaurant is stylish, boasting a modern setting and a welcoming ambiance.

If you wish to enjoy a beverage with your delicious meal, go for their bubble tea. It comes in many flavors, including Thai tea, coffee, honeydew, taro, and green tea.

Cloud 9

Address: 308 S Lake Ave, Duluth, MN 55802, United States

Website: Cloud 9

Opening hours: Tue - Thu: 11am - 9pm; Fri - Sat: 11am - 10pm; Sun: 12pm - 9pm (closed on Mon)

3. Caribou Coffee

Set the tone for a beautiful day in Duluth by starting your day with a hearty breakfast at Caribou Coffee. This popular coffee shop in Canal Park is famed for its all-day breakfast menu, seasonal drinks, and handcrafted beverages such as coffee, mochas, and lattes.

Crowd favorites include Iced White Pumpkin Mocha, Blended Bousted Apple Blast, Maple Waffle Sandwich, and Pumpkin bread. Catch their seasonal bubble drinks, too! Flavors such as Raspberry Green Tea, Sparkling Green Tea Lemonade, and Matcha Tea Cooler are sure to please discerning palates.

Caribou Coffee

Address: 307 Canal Park Dr, Duluth, MN 55802, United States

Website: Caribou Coffee

Opening hours: Sun - Wed: 6am - 7pm; Thu - Sat: 6am - 8pm
